Sitting Bull College is a Public, 4-years school located in Fort Yates, ND and Bismarck State College (BSC) is a Public, 4-years school located in Bismarck, ND.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• Bismarck State College (3,771 students) is larger than Sitting Bull College (257 students).
  • Bismarck State College has more expensive tuition & fees of $7,279 than Sitting Bull College($4,010).
  • Bismarck State College has more full-time faculties of 121 faculties than Sitting Bull College(28 facluties).
